See More Details >>Becoming a carpenter in Springfield, OR typically begins with an apprenticeship, blending hands-on experience with classroom instruction, allowing individuals to earn while they learn. Apprenticeships last about four to five years, requiring many hours of training under licensed professionals. According to the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ics, there are approximately 352,779 carpenters nationwide, with an average annual salary of $41,748, translating to about $816 per week. The carpentry trade in Springfield, OR, projects a 1.1% job growth from 2019 to 2024, with apprentices earning an average of $774 per week. Trade schools, unions, and platforms like the North Atlantic States Regional Council of Carpenters help aspiring carpenters find apprenticeship opportunities, leading to a career with strong earning potential, often exceeding $80,000 annually for experienced professionals.
